2. Summarize what the article, "The Meaning of the Truman Show" is saying.

 "The Truman Show" is talking about a " World Pouplar Tv Star" who actually  lives in a "fake real world" under the camera in 24 hours. The story in his life has perfectly developed and designed by a genius televsion director. The funny thing is, his friends, his family, his wife, his frist love, his classmates, the people who also "lives" in the island are all actors, and Truman has lived in this "fake-real life" almost 30 years until one day he realizes the strange things have kept happening in his world. He is trying to figure out the answer and acrros oversea to find out another world. In the end, he would like to go out rather staying in this "fake-real world".
